DESCRIPTION:Speakers: Elise Goujard (Université de Nantes)\n\nGluing the 
 opposite sides of a square gives a flat torus: a torus endowed with a flat
  metric induced by the Euclidean metric on the square. Similarly\, one can
  produce higher genus surfaces by gluing parallel sides of several squares
 . These "square-tiled surfaces" inherit from the squares a flat metric wit
 h conical singularities. In this talk we will present several recent resul
 ts and conjectures on the large genus asymptotics of these surfaces\, and 
 more generally of some families of flat surfaces (joint work with V. Delec
 roix\, P. Zograf and A. Zorich). We will also see how these results can be
  interpreted in the language of closed curves on surfaces. We will finish 
 with some recent results joint with E. Duryev and I. Yakovlev that should 
 allow to generalize these results to a larger family of flat surfaces.\n
